ESP, IoT WiFi лампа-будильник. Обсуждение прошивки от GUNNER47

ЗДЕСЬ ОБСУЖДАЕМ ТОЛЬКО ДАННУЮ ПРОШИВКУ
ВСЕ ЧТО НЕ ПО СИЯ ТЕМЕ И ПРОШИВКЕ, ВСЕ СНОСИТСЯ НА@@@!

Очень просим не делать репост "ЦИТИРОВАНИЕ" сообщений! Делать только в КРАЙНЕЙ необходимости, удаляя лишний текст (у нас не ЧАТ)!
Иначе опять будет 160 страниц и 0 пользы ....

Для ответа КОНКРЕТНОМУ пользователю, достаточно нажать " ОТВЕТ"

При описании проблемы обязательно, как можно подробнее, описывайте ход своих действий до ее возникновения. Телепатов (как я думаю) среди участников нет. Потом 20 постов будет только для того, чтобы Вас понять.
Если Вы считаете ваше сообщение важным и его нужно поднять в шапку, пишите мне в личку с пометкой "Сообщение в шапку"


ПО ВОПРОСАМ РАБОТЫ ПРИЛОЖЕНИЯ ОТ KOTEYKA ИДЕМ В ЭТУ ТЕМУ

Голосовое управление лампой Гайвера, через Яндекс Алису (прошивка Gunner47).

Яндекс диск Файл ПДФ. Актуально на 27.01.2020г
наш сервер НЕ ОБНОВЛЯЕТСЯ, от 27.01.2020г
Прошивка gunner47 v.2 "86 эффектов в 1" или уже больше - разработку ведет @Сотнег
Прошивка gunner47 v.2.X_web : веб-интерфейс (без необходимости перепрошивки) - разработку ведет @alvikskor
Прошивка от Shaitan с поддержкой mp3 и пульта (тут не обсуждается. Обсуждается в теме прошивки)
Прошивка FireLamp with Remote Control - разработку ведет @SlingMaster

Для тех у кого умный дом Home Assistant есть отличный компонент

ВНИМАНИЕ! Если у вас не компилируется или не загружается скетч - значит вы сделали что-то неправильно. Специально для вас созданы две темы:
ESP8266, проблема с компиляцией скетча
ESP8266, проблема с загрузкой скетча
Читайте (ЧИТАЙТЕ! Не пишите!) эти темы, там уже есть решение вашей проблемы.
Здесь подобные вопросы считаются оффтопом и молча удаляются, а авторы получают баллы нарушений.
 
Изменено:

Комментарии

mechanic

★★★★✩✩✩
Команда форума
31 Июл 2018
403
206
ЗДЕСЬ ОБСУЖДАЕМ ТОЛЬКО ДАННУЮ ПРОШИВКУ
ВСЕ ЧТО НЕ ПО СИЯ ТЕМЕ И ПРОШИВКЕ, ВСЕ СНОСИТСЯ НА@@@!

Очень просим не делать репост "ЦИТИРОВАНИЕ" сообщений! Делать только в КРАЙНЕЙ необходимости, удаляя лишний текст (у нас не ЧАТ)!
Иначе опять будет 160 страниц и 0 пользы ....

Для ответа КОНКРЕТНОМУ пользователю, достаточно нажать " ОТВЕТ"

При описании проблемы обязательно, как можно подробнее, описывайте ход своих действий до ее возникновения. Телепатов (как я думаю) среди участников нет. Потом 20 постов будет только для того, чтобы Вас понять.
Если Вы считаете ваше сообщение важным и его нужно поднять в шапку, пишите мне в личку с пометкой "Сообщение в шапку"


ПО ВОПРОСАМ РАБОТЫ ПРИЛОЖЕНИЯ ОТ KOTEYKA ИДЕМ В ЭТУ ТЕМУ

Голосовое управление лампой Гайвера, через Яндекс Алису (прошивка Gunner47).

Яндекс диск Файл ПДФ. Актуально на 27.01.2020г
наш сервер НЕ ОБНОВЛЯЕТСЯ, от 27.01.2020г
Прошивка gunner47 v.2 "86 эффектов в 1" или уже больше - разработку ведет @Сотнег
Прошивка gunner47 v.2.X_web : веб-интерфейс (без необходимости перепрошивки) - разработку ведет @alvikskor
Прошивка от Shaitan с поддержкой mp3 и пульта (тут не обсуждается. Обсуждается в теме прошивки)
Прошивка FireLamp with Remote Control - разработку ведет @SlingMaster

Для тех у кого умный дом Home Assistant есть отличный компонент

ВНИМАНИЕ! Если у вас не компилируется или не загружается скетч - значит вы сделали что-то неправильно. Специально для вас созданы две темы:
ESP8266, проблема с компиляцией скетча
ESP8266, проблема с загрузкой скетча
Читайте (ЧИТАЙТЕ! Не пишите!) эти темы, там уже есть решение вашей проблемы.
Здесь подобные вопросы считаются оффтопом и молча удаляются, а авторы получают баллы нарушений.
 
Изменено:

Shaitan

★★★✩✩✩✩
17 Фев 2020
182
165
@Koteyka, Например вечером цветок или смайлик нарисовал, а утром он после рассвета загорелся. Игрушка, а приятно. Достаточно в памяти хранить, пока лампа включена.
 

Koteyka 🐱

★★★★★★✩
Команда форума
27 Окт 2019
935
556
54
Днепр, Украина
firelamp.pp.ua
Достаточно в памяти хранить, пока лампа включена.
Так это нужно хранить состояние каждого диода 256 байт , цвет каждого закрашенного диода по 7 байт, если цвет будет в HEX это как минимум.
Получается 256 + 256*7 = 2048 только для хранения вашего художества.
Многовато.
Как вариант, хранить его в телефоне, а при подключении выгружать, но это не совсем удобно и слишком много кода писать.
 
Изменено:

EGORka

★✩✩✩✩✩✩
15 Мар 2020
87
37
Ребята может я глупый вопрос задам с точки зрения программера, а никак нельзя сихронизировать время в режиме точки доступа, со смартфоном или вернее выводить время без синхронизации с серверами, а каким то образом беря его с часов смартфона?
Прошивка у меня 1.5 от Gunner47 и как я не изгалялся не хочет лампа в сеть домашнюю попасть. вообще никак. А время чтоб выводилось хочется.
 

kDn

★★★★★✩✩
18 Ноя 2019
1,103
437
@EGORka, обсуждаемые здесь прошивки данной возможности не поддерживают, у себя же реализовал синхронизацию как через веб, NTP и ручную установку времени. Так что все возможно, но вряд ли кто-то этим будет заниматься в ближайшее время :) .
 

EGORka

★✩✩✩✩✩✩
15 Мар 2020
87
37
Понятно, буду пытаться соединить лампу с роутером. Хотя уж что только не пробовал. И сеть нефильтрована, и пароль простой делал и защиту менял и менял страну . Не хочет цепляться...
 

Shaitan

★★★✩✩✩✩
17 Фев 2020
182
165
@Koteyka, картинка CRGB 16*16*3 = 768 байт.
То есть еще можно немного памяти куснуть.

Скетч использует 468720 байт (44%) памяти устройства. Всего доступно 1044464 байт.
Глобальные переменные используют 44276 байт (54%) динамической памяти, оставляя 37644 байт для локальных переменных. Максимум: 81920 байт.

а чем обусловлена плавающая передача цвета?
Входящая строка - COL;255;0;128
Входящая строка - COL;254;0;127
Входящая строка - COL;254;0;127
Входящая строка - COL;254;1;126
Входящая строка - COL;254;1;126
Входящая строка - COL;254;1;126
 

Koteyka 🐱

★★★★★★✩
Команда форума
27 Окт 2019
935
556
54
Днепр, Украина
firelamp.pp.ua
картинка CRGB 16*16*3 = 768 байт.
Храниться будет не картинка, а параметры каждого диода. По одному байту на состояние. Цвет #FFFFFF 7 байт + доп информация, типа номер диода и т.д.
Можно цвет и в RGB сделать, но это будет 255,255,255 = 11 байт. И храниться это всё будет в энергонезависимой памяти.
А завтра вы захотите несколько эффектов добавить и плата ляжет при сохранении вашего изображения из-за недостатка памяти.
 

kDn

★★★★★✩✩
18 Ноя 2019
1,103
437
не поделишься командой? а я тогда через IR пульт добавлю.
В моей прошивке отдельный класс отвечающий за синхронизацию - код открыт, можете брать; ручной ввод организован через веб-страницу, с установкой соответствующих признаков.
 

ale)(

✩✩✩✩✩✩✩
2 Авг 2019
12
3
Ребят , объясните пожалуйста, как последние прошивки от Palpalych собирать в ардуино ide. Я чёт но понял чего делать.
 

kDn

★★★★★✩✩
18 Ноя 2019
1,103
437

Shaitan

★★★✩✩✩✩
17 Фев 2020
182
165
@EGORka, RTC DS1307 надо еще цеплять по I2C, занимать 2 ноги... но тогда время будет сохранятся при пропадании питания.

Сразу после включения без синхронизации в строке состояния время показывается 3 часа ночи. То есть внутренний счетчик есть. Если его задать вручную, то часы будут работать, правда до первой перезагрузки, поэтому толку с них никакого.
 

kDn

★★★★★✩✩
18 Ноя 2019
1,103
437
Как я понял эта хренька на ардуино время подает, а в приложении пункт -вывести его на матрицу. Это возможно ?
Прикрутить часы реального времени? Да конечно можно, у меня несколько их валяется. Но к ним нужна батарейка и начальная установка времени.
 

Koteyka 🐱

★★★★★★✩
Команда форума
27 Окт 2019
935
556
54
Днепр, Украина
firelamp.pp.ua
  • Лойс +1
Реакции: EGORka и Shaitan

kDn

★★★★★✩✩
18 Ноя 2019
1,103
437
Батарейка да. А начальная установка запросто заливается при заливке всей прошивки
В принципе да, можно тот же unixtime передать. Но также не стоит забывать о переходах зимнее/летнее время и часовых поясах :)
 
  • Лойс +1
Реакции: Koteyka 🐱

Shaitan

★★★✩✩✩✩
17 Фев 2020
182
165
Адаптировал блуждающий кубик под цилиндр, добавил отскакивание от нарисованных в приложении от @Koteyka элементов с частичным их разрущением. Типа арканоид.
Получилось забавно.
 

ssp1971

★★✩✩✩✩✩
14 Мар 2020
108
71
@Shaitan, Вторая жизнь кубика! Это хорошо, а то он мало кому нравился. Революцию в эффектах сделали прыгающие мячики. У вас заявка на победу?
 
  • Лойс +1
Реакции: Belokota

ssp1971

★★✩✩✩✩✩
14 Мар 2020
108
71
Прикрутил к wemos ардуино нано для управления с пульта. Получилось реализовать одинарное, двойное, тройное и яркость одной кнопкой (аналог удержания кнопкой). Помогите пожалуйста как добавить одно нажатие затем удержание (для скорости) и и 2 нажатия затем удержание (для масштаба). Там ещё реле организованно через мосфет реле это для перебрасывания контакта "сигнал" ленты для использования нано в других проэктах (работает отлично к стати. хотчу в дальнейшем цветомузыку на нано залить). Спасибо. Сам как видите не программист. Понимаю что калхоз, но могу надеяться только на себя.
 

Вложения

  • 3.2 KB Просмотры: 10
Изменено:

Николай_викт

✩✩✩✩✩✩✩
13 Янв 2020
20
1
@EGORka, У меня была подобная проблема. Вроде подключался к сети, c роутером, после отпадал . Решилось сменой на роутере канала 12 на канал 4 и изменением шифрования .
 
Изменено:

smirnov8

✩✩✩✩✩✩✩
2 Фев 2020
12
1
@Palpalych, Залил вашу прошивку, и все заработало, но... Так как у меня высота ленты 26 а ширина 16 изменил эти параметры в константах. и вроде бы все ничего, но некоторые эффекты работают не корректно. Снегопад, например, только самая верхняя строка моргает белыми светодиодами, RAINBOW COMET и NOISE STREAMS работают с разрешением 16х16))). Решил текст сделать по середине лампы и поднял его на 9-ю строку светодиодов, но затемнение эффекта для бегущей строки осталось внизу )))))) как затемнение поднять???))))
 
Изменено:

Koteyka 🐱

★★★★★★✩
Команда форума
27 Окт 2019
935
556
54
Днепр, Украина
firelamp.pp.ua
Помогите пожалуйста как добавить одно нажатие затем удержание (для скорости) и и 2 нажатия затем удержание (для масштаба).
С пультом это сложнее сделать. Там код кнопки отдается один раз, потом идут FFFFFF
Я делал как-то такую реализацию, найду, выложу.
 
  • Лойс +1
Реакции: Shaitan